Beware Of The Trick : The SureWin Scam Exposed
Are you tired of losing scams? Regrettably, the internet is rife with bogus schemes designed surewin cheat money to con unsuspecting individuals. One such scam that has been exploiting people lately is the infamous SureWin scheme. This manipulative operation promises easy money, luring victims with the fantasy of effortless wealth.
But don't fall. The SureWin scam is a masterpiece, designed to capitalize on your desires. Here's how it works and what steps to take to avoid being scammed.
- To begin with, the SureWin scam will often appear credible. They may have a professional website, offer testimonials from fake winners, and even promote their services on social media.
- Next, they'll urge you to invest your money quickly. They may claim that there are a limited number of slots available or that the opportunity is only open for a brief time.
- Finally, once you've invested, you'll be told that you need to deposit more money to access your profits. This is a classic indicator that something is wrong.
